Register both 32- as well as 64-bit shell extensions
I'm currently running a 32-bit file manager (XYplorer) on the 64-bit version of Windows 7, which means that EmEditor's 64-bit shell extension isn't available.

As EmEditor's 32-bit shell extension is already available for the 32-bit version, would it be possible to include and register both the 32- as well as 64-bit shell extensions, when installing the 64-bit version? It would aid users of file managers that are (for now) stuck without a native 64-bit version (FreeCommander is another one).

P.S.:
1. I am aware of several good file managers that do have 64-bit versions, but I simply prefer XYplorer to them.
2. The SendTo-shortcut is a workaround, but is also an additional and less discoverable (not visible in the main context menu) click.
